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team begins by assessing the affected area to find out the extent of the damage and the best course of action. This involves identifying the source of the water damage, the type of carpet pad and underlying materials used, and any potential health risks associated with mold and bacteria growth.

Step 2: Water Extraction and Removal

We use specialized equipment to extract as much water as possible from the affected area, including the carpet pad and underlying materials.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old and bacteria growth.

Step 3: Drying and Cleaning

Once the water has been extracted, our team uses specialized equipment and techniques to dry and clean the affected area. This may involve using dehumidifiers, fans, and other equipment to speed up the drying process, as well as antimicrobial treatments to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ria.

Step 4: Restoration and Reinstallation

Once the affected area has been dried and cleaned, our team can begin the process of restoring the area to its original condition. This may involve reinstalling new carpet, padding, and other materials, as well as any necessary repairs to the underlying structure of the home.

Warning Signs You Need Carpet Pad Water Extraction

Burnt Store Marina, FL homeowners often overlook the warning signs of carpet pad water damage, leading to costly repairs and even health issues for family members.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of mold and bacteria growth in your carpet pad and underlying materials. If you notice a musty smell that persists even after cleaning or air freshening, it may be a sign that you need Carpet Pad Water Extraction.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Visible water stains or discoloration on your carpet or walls can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ual stains or discoloration, it’s essential to have your carpet pad inspected for dam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age to your carpet pad and underlying materials. If you notice any uneven or buckled flooring, it’s crucial to have your carpet pad inspected for damage.

Increased Humidity or Moisture

Increased humidity or moisture in your home can be a sign of water damage to your carpet pad and underlying materials. If you notice any unusual changes in humidity or moisture levels, it’s essential to have your carpet pad inspected for damage.

Unpleasant Odors from Your HVAC System

Unpleasant odors from your HVAC system can be a sign of mold and bacteria growth in your carpet pad and underlying materials. If you notice any unusual odors from your HVAC system, it’s crucial to have your carpet pad inspected for damage.

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ew

Visible signs of mold or mildew on your carpet, walls, or ceilings can be a sign of water damage to your carpet pad and underlying materials. If you notice any unusual growth or discoloration, it’s essential to have your carpet pad inspected for damage.

Q: What is the difference between water extraction and drying?

A: Water extraction refers to the process of removing standing water from the affected area, while drying refers to the process of removing excess moisture from the affected area.
